Where does Searchomepage.com come from?

According to our researchers, this search engine comes with a suspicious browser extension called NewTabTV. This extension may alter your browser settings without your knowledge and that is how Searchomepage.com can appear in your browsers. So any time you open Internet Explorer, Google Chrome, and Mozilla Firefox, you will find this search engine as your home page. It is quite possible that you got infected with the browser extension while you were visiting a freeware or torrent website.

Did you know that infected freeware bundles are mainly promoted on shady P2P websites? Have you noticed that these sites contain third-party ads that are rather misleading, including buttons that pretend to be part of the webpage content in order to trick unsuspecting users into clicking on them? It is quite likely that you clicked on such an ad or a pop-up ad on such a website because that is usually how people get infected with this extension and, as a result, with Searchomepage.com as well. What does Searchomepage.com do?

This search engine is a completely useless tool because it only uses a redirection instead of generating its own search results pages. Once you enter your search keywords, you will find yourself on a Google results page. Why would you use a questionable search tool when you have reputable and trustworthy alternatives, such as Google, Yahoo!, and Bing? You need to know that this search engine may also collect information about you, including your search queries and might use its third-party services to present you with customized ads and links. We do not advise you to click on any of those as they might lead you to unsafe websites. In order to stop unpleasant things from happening, you should delete Searchomepage.com as soon as you can.

Searchomepage.com Removal from Browsers

Mozilla Firefox

  1. Press Alt+H and choose Troubleshooting Information.
  2. Click Refresh Firefox.
  3. Click Refresh Firefox once more in the pop-up.
  4. Click Finish.

Google Chrome

  1. Press Alt+F and go to Settings.
  2. Click Show advanced settings at the bottom.
  3. Click Reset settings at the bottom.
  4. Press Reset.

Internet Explorer

  1. Press Alt+T and access Internet Options.
  2. Under the Advanced tab, press Reset.
  3. Mark the Delete personal settings checkbox.
  4. Press Reset.
  5. Press Close.
